The blepharoplasty surgery, which is also known as an eye lift or some other lay terms along those lines is the removal of extra skin and fat from the upper lids and from the lower lids. I think it is important that patients and doctors to recognize that eyelids do not exist by themselves. The eyebrows often times have an effect on what appears to be extra skin for the upper eyelids, so the physician, a plastic surgeon, really needs to go over with the patient carefully in the examination and the analysis of what these different components have or contribute to the condition of extra eyelid skin and then determine which procedure is best for the patient and what that look is going to be like afterwards, and often times with the help of computer imaging, we can show befores and afters of elevation of the brows or just plain removal of the extra upper eyelid skin, so the patient can have an idea of what these differences will do for them. The lower eyelids, we usually take out the fat from inside the eyelid itself, so there is no external incision. The only time we use external incisions now is if there is an extreme amount of extra skin, but I rather tighten this skin with either chemical peel or laser while removing the fat from the inside of the eyelid, so there is no external incisions, and these conditions that we usually treat with the eyelid surgery is the puffiness, the bagginess, the extra skin that hangs over the eyelids and it sometimes even impairs the patient’s vision. With blepharoplasty surgery, there is very minimal discomfort following the surgery. We have the patients ice their eyes and they usually take very minor analgesics for the first day or two, and usually after that, they take nothing. With the blepharoplasty surgery, the sutures the usually removed in four to five days, and usually can apply makeup in about five to seven days, and many patients will be back to work within a week or so. The final results; however, are not seen until about three or four months, but the changes are immediately apparent, but it keeps getting better over a period of time.
